Abstrak

This study examines the adjudicatory authority of the State Administrative Court (PTUN) over lawsuits that designate the Audit Report (LHP) of the Supreme Audit Board (BPK) as the object of administrative dispute. Employing normative legal research with statutory, conceptual, and case study approaches based on PTUN Medan Decision Number 55/G/2025/PTUN. MDN, this article addresses two primary questions: first, whether PTUN possesses absolute competence to adjudicate lawsuits against BPK audit reports; second, whether BPK audit reports qualify as State Administrative Decisions (KTUN). The findings demonstrate that PTUN lacks jurisdiction because BPK exercises a constitutional function of state financial auditing that is independent and distinct from governmental administrative functions. BPK audit reports do not satisfy the elements of KTUN as stipulated in Article 1(9) of Law Number 51 of 2009 in conjunction with Article 87 of Law Number 30 of 2014. The PTUN Medan decision reinforces consistent Supreme Court jurisprudence placing BPK audit reports beyond PTUN's absolute competence. This research contributes to Indonesian administrative law doctrine by clarifying PTUN's jurisdictional boundaries and safeguarding BPK's constitutional independence.
